Структура byte (system)

Byte Тип підтримує стандартні арифметичні операції, такі як додавання, віднімання, ділення, множення, віднімання, заперечення і Унарне заперечення. Інші цілочисельні типи, такі як Byte тип також підтримує побітового AND. OR. XOR. залишити shift і оператори зсуву вправо.

Можна використовувати стандартні числові оператори для порівняння двох Byte значення, або викликати CompareTo або Equals метод.

Можна також викликати члени Math класом для виконання різноманітних математичних операцій, включаючи отримання абсолютне значення числа, обчислення приватне і залишок від цілочисельного ділення, визначення максимального або мінімального значення з двох цілих чисел, отримання знак числа і округлення чисел.

Byte Типу забезпечує повну підтримку рядки стандартних і настроюються числових форматів. (Докладніше див. У розділі Типи форматування в .NET Framework. Рядки стандартних числових форматів. І Рядки настроюються числових форматів.) Однак найчастіше байтових значень представлені у вигляді значення однозначне для трьох цифр без додаткового форматування або як шістнадцяткові значення двох цифр.

Для форматування Byte значення як цілочисельний рядок без попередніх нулів, можна викликати без параметрів ToString () метод. За допомогою описателя формату «D», можна також включити вказане число початкових нулів в строковому поданні. За допомогою описателя формату «X», може становити Byte значення в вигляді шестнадцатеричной рядки. Наступний приклад форматує елементи масиву Byte значення трьома способами.

Схожі статті